Update: Construction Partners Shares Rise After Reporting Preliminary Fiscal 2024 Results, Sets Fiscal 2025 Guidance
Oct 21, 2024 8:32 PM

12:15 PM EDT, 10/21/2024 (MT Newswires) -- (Updates with stock price movement in the headline and first paragraph.)

Construction Partners ( ROAD ) shares jumped nearly 11% in recent Monday trading after the company said it expects fiscal year 2024 net income of $68 million to $70 million, compared with $49 million in fiscal 2023.

Analysts polled by Capital IQ expect $74.8 million.

The civil infrastructure company expects fiscal 2024 revenue of $1.82 billion to $1.83 billion, compared with $1.56 billion in fiscal 2023.

Analysts surveyed by Capital IQ expect $1.84 billion.

For 2025, Construction Partners ( ROAD ) said it expects net income of $90 million to $106 million and revenue of $2.42 billion to $2.52 billion. Analysts polled by Capital IQ expect net income of $94.6 million and revenue of $2.08 billion.

Price: 82.72, Change: +8.02, Percent Change: +10.73
